    RUSSEL(L) The name Russell, apparently Lumbee, appears on Bladen tax
    lists of 1761, 1768, and 1769. Wm. Russell patented 130 acres east of
    Saddletree Swamp 20 Oct. 176l. Thomas Russell lived on five Mile Branch
    of Saddleltree Swamp in 1773 (Bladen County Deeds, 1738-1779, 419-420).
    Thomas Russle and Thomas Ivy sold land they jointly patented on
    Saddletree Swamp to Phillip Blount 27 Sept. 1787 (Deed Book A, 147-149).
    Thomas Russell lived near Thomas Butcher adjacent to a grant made to
    Augustin Willis 26 Nov. 1789 on Wilson's Great Branch (Deed Book B,
    102). There were several land dealings with other Lumbees such as the sale
    of 100 acres by Major Russell to Edmond Revel 12 June 1790 for land east
    of Drounding creek and northeast of Jacob Swamp (Deed Book B, 185-186)
    adjacent to a 200 acre tract patented by Thomas Russell. There was a Joseph
    Russell who witnessed a deed in Robeson 13 Nov. 1792 (Deed Book C, 303-
    304). The names James, Sampson, Thomas and William Russell appeared on
    Robeson deed records up to 1800 and later. The surname does not appear in
    the 1850 census of Robeson.

    BELL A Thomas Bell owned a square mile of land next to Col. William
    Eaton in Granville County in 1754. His son Samuel Bell enlisted there in
    1761. There was a Samuel Bell whose Revolutionary War Service reported
    that he was born in Surry County, Virginia in 1749. He lived in Sampson
    County, N.C. from 1782 to 1807 and lived in Robeson from about 1807 until
    1832. John Bell, listed as white in Capt. Abram Barnes' district of south
    Robeson and probably Lumbee, appeared in the 1776 and 1786 tax lists of
    Bladen and in 1786 was listed with a wife and daughter. The Bell name
    appears in Robeson records of 1780 and 1784 and in Sampson County in
    1790. Robeson grantee and grantor deeds show John Bell with 200 acres on
    Turkey Branch in 1787 and 10 acres additional in 1789. John Bell left a will
    dated 1788 (Will Book I, 16). Mary Bell left a will dated 1804 (Will Book I,
    88). Cheraw County, S.C. had William, Frederickson, Levi, Thomas and
    William Bell with land grants between 1785 and 1797 (Royal Land Grants,
    -/0-
    Craven, Cheraw and Chesterfield Counties, C.C.). Some Bells in the 1850
    Robeson census reported being born in Robeson by 1800. Mary Bell had 50
    acres on Bridge Branch in 1803 and 150 acres on Hogg Swamp in 1808.
    Samuel Bell had 223 acres south of Ten Mile Swamp in 1807. This tract
    went from Samuel to Hardy H. Bell in 1819. Hardy H. Bell (1790-1866), a
    powerful landowner and Lumberton storeowner who married Sarah Parker
    c1820, had eighteen deeds on Ten Mile, the Stage Road, Saddletree Swamp,
    Great Marsh and along the Lumber River filed between 1840 and 1865. The
    surname was listed in S1. Pauls Township in 1880. Bell was self-identified as
    Indian in the 1900 Census of Robeson and listed on the 1900 Indian
    Schedule. The Directory of Robeson County, 1900, lists the "Croatan" name
    of Bell in the Rozier community The name was listed as Indian in the 1930
    census of Pembroke Township. Death records of Robeson of 1916 and 1936
    show the Indian name Bell as primarily in Saddletree but a numerous name
    allover Robeson, in Lumberton, Lumber Bridge, Pembroke, Saddletree and
    Union townships. Cited at Bethel Hill Church cemetery and numerous other
    locations by Jane Blanks Barnhill, Sacred Grounds, 2007, a listing of 162
    Lumbee cemeteries in Robeson County. Those named Bell were attending
    Pembroke State College by the 1940s. The name Bell is not found in any
    other tri-racial isolate groups (DeMarce, 1992).
